Meghdootam evokes tremendous response

Tuesday, 24 September 2019 | Staff Reporter | Bhopal

Meghdootam, a three-day exhibition of painter Raghuvir Ambar based on Mahakavi Kalidas's work Meghdoot, recieved a tremendous response that concluded on Monday.

The story of Meghdoot was beautifully showcased through the painting exhibition. It was the solo painting exhibition.

The exhibition was inaugurated by Devilal Patidar and Sajid Premi, senior painters of Bhopal at the Swaraj Bhavan Art Gallery.

The artist, Raghuveer Ambar gave color to the eloquent poetry of Mahakavi Kalidasa. The paintings made by Ambar on canvas reflect every sense and every mood of Kalidasa's voice.

The delineations of human figures in the pictures reflect their fine vision.

It is to be noted that as many as 40 paintings were made based on the verses of Meghdoot of painter Raghuvir Ambar.

Painter Ambar told that Mahakavi Kalidas has described the punishment given to the Yaksha in Meghdoot due to a mistake in the rule of Kubera. Yaksha sends a message through cloud to his spouse during exile.

After simple translation of Meghdoot composed in Sanskrit in Hindi, the image in the picture is engraved. Drawings made with simple watercolor.

Beautifully created art works enthralled the spectators at the gallery. Not only this, the spectators received a chance to have a close look at the scenes of legendary story.
